Video: Andy Cole praises ex-Spur who could have played for Manchester United

Andy Cole has claimed that Ledley King could have played for Manchester United if he had been able to avoid his injury issues.

The central defender announced his retirement in 2012 having suffered from chronic knee problems in the years leading up to his decision which limited his game and training time.

King, who had captained Tottenham since 2005 admitted that the decision to quit was tough, and after spending his entire career at the club, he could not consider playing elsewhere (Telegraph).

Cole, who made 274 appearances for United praised the ability of the England international describing him as one of the best.
